Summary/Objective: WePlay is seeking a compassionate and experienced Board Certified Behavior Analyst to work with children and adolescents diagnosed with autism spectrum disorder. The successful candidate will be responsible for overseeing a caseload of clients, managing and training Registered Behavior Technicians, and working collaboratively with parents, schools, and other ancillary service providers.
Basic Job Responsibilities:
- Conduct initial and ongoing assessments
- Including administering VB-MAP and other assessment tools, creating and updating individualized treatment plans, and other pertinent documentation required by insurance.
- Maintain a caseload of approximately 10 clients
- Create appropriate program goals and interventions for clients
- Monitor progress and data and make changes to programming and interventions as necessary
- Create and maintain client records, including contact notes and session notes, as required by insurance companies
- Provide parent training and regular communication to parents of clients on caseload.
- Provide ongoing supervision and training to Registered Behavior Technicians.
- Provide ongoing supervision and training to students pursuing the BCBA credential.
- Assist in managing daily operations of the clinic setting including: opening and closing the building, maintaining client schedules, and providing direct 1:1 therapy when needed.
- Collaborate with school personnel and other ancillary service providers as needed.

Requirements
- Master’s degree in Applied Behavior Analysis or equivalent coursework.
- Active certification as Board Certified Behavior Analyst.
- Experience maintaining a caseload of clients as a Board Certified Behavior Analyst.
- Experience working with children and adolescents with a wide range of needs
- Knowledge of the principles of Applied Behavior Analysis
- Strong interpersonal skills and the ability to work as part of a cohesive team.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ills
